This is a list of the largest trading partners of Italy based on data from the Ministry of Economic Development of Italy.[1] Export in Billion EUR Rank | Country | Export (2017) | 1. | {{flag|Germany}} | 55.8 | 2. | {{flag|France}} | 46.1 | 3. | {{flag|United States}} | 40.5 | 4. | {{flag|Spain}} | 23.2 | 5. | {{flag|United Kingdom}} | 23.1 | 6. | {{flag|Switzerland}} | 20.6 | 7. | {{flag|Belgium}} | 13.5 | 8. | {{flag|China}} | 13.5 | 9. | {{flag|Poland}} | 12.6 | 10. | {{flag|Netherlands}} | 10.5 | |
| Import in Billion EUR Rank | Country | Import (2017) | 1. | {{flag|Germany}} | 65.3 | 2. | {{flag|France}} | 35.2 | 3. | {{flag|China}} | 28.4 | 4. | {{flag|Netherlands}} | 22.5 | 5. | {{flag|Spain}} | 21.1 | 6. | {{flag|Belgium}} | 18 | 7. | {{flag|United States}} | 15 | 8. | {{flag|Russia}} | 12.3 | 9. | {{flag|United Kingdom}} | 11.4 | 10. | {{flag|Switzerland}} | 11.1 | |
